About this course

arrow
This program at Weber State focuses on preparing students for careers in theatre design and technical management. It offers a diverse range of courses and practical experiences, giving students the skills needed to succeed in various theatre industry roles. Students have the opportunity to design and manage award-winning productions, enhancing their hands-on experience outside the classroom. The curriculum emphasizes innovation, resourcefulness, critical thinking, collaboration, and problem-solving, ensuring graduates are well-equipped for the industry.

Career prospects

arrow
Graduates can work as set designers, managers, and in other theatre-related roles across Broadway, theme parks, cruise ships, film, and television. The program’s students find employment throughout the country, showcasing the strong career opportunities after completing this degree.
